"CaptnKirk" wrote:
| I have gone through the threads for my original error message 0x80070424 and 
| a subsequent error message 0x80070005 and am still unable to run automated 
| updates.  Now when I try to get automated updates I just get "update failed" 
| and no error message.  
| 
| When I try to download BITS from the Website directly, I get a message that 
| service Pac Version is newer than you are applying - No need to install this 
| update.
| 
| When I run Services.msc, I get a message "could not start BITS Service on 
| local computer.  It gives me Error number 2 "The system cannot find the 
| specified file."  Automated updates does now say Startup type: Automatic and 
| Service Status" Started
| 
| How can I fix BITS so Automated Updates will work?"
